<p>Last summer I was over at Clarks Park in Clarksville, Indiana attempting to paint the skyline of Louisville, when I turned around and saw this delightful 2-story building.  It was early Sunday morning and it looked like people were going in for brunch.  I couldn&#8217;t pass up taking photos and just last week I got around to painting it.   I actually started this painting as a demonstration for my watercolor class and I liked it so much, I developed it into a completed painting.  I would like to paint it again on a much larger scale.  I think there may be an insurance or realty office up on the second  floor.  If anyone knows the name of this building or the restaurant, please let me know.   I&#8217;d like to improve  upon the title of the painting&#8211;may have to ride over there to investigate!</p>

<p>If you&#8217;ve traveled Hwy 60 between Louisville and Shelbyville, you probably remember seeing this roadside grocery. It has been there for many years and is a landmark for anyone that grew up in this area. It is a great place to stop and is as interesting inside as it is out.</p>
